SCIENCETECHNOLOGYENGINEERINGMATHEMATICSSCIENCETECHNOLOGYENGINEERINGMATHEMATICS Museum of Discovery and Science and United Way of Broward County APP•titude 2 1 Broward County students entering their Junior year in August 2017 are invited to apply for a two-year internship that will provide an opportunity to earn volunteer service hours, college credit, and a stipend while advancing their knowledge in STEM education. The program begins in the Fall of 2017 and runs through May 2018 at the Museum of Discovery and Science. Students will meet at the Museum a minimum of two times per month and also participate in Florida Atlantic University College of Engineering and Computer Science’s three-week, dual-enrollment course in Summer 2018. Upon successful completion of this college level course, students will receive three semester hours of college credit.
